Output 56d20c6968311797e395e2999ea81e3d03060b5c1faeb5f1e3260a3cdbe43785:0

value
43912037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a00d35d6abae69697359e99d3d912b08102fcd OP_EQUAL
address
3QB3tKBjr7hNZP4mGxUN7xmCPVSaWShjPq
transaction
56d20c6968311797e395e2999ea81e3d03060b5c1faeb5f1e3260a3cdbe43785
spent
true